What is the purpose of the red envelopes that people share at the Chinese New Year?

At Lunar New Year, it’s tradition to give the gift of a bright, beautiful red envelope (known as 紅包, hóngbāo) to your friends and family. But not just any old envelope. These are filled with money – and symbolize good wishes and luck for the new year ahead.

Who gives red packets?

1. Why do Chinese give red envelopes during Chinese New Year? Chinese people love the color red, and regard red as the symbol of energy, happiness, and good luck. Sending red envelopes is a way to send good wishes and luck (as well as money).

Red envelopes or hongbao in Mandarin and lai see in Cantonese are small red and gold packets containing money given to children, family members, friends and employees as a symbol of good luck. In Chinese culture, the color red is associated with energy, happiness and good luck.

When do you give red packets?

It is common to give a red envelope during many other occasions, such as a wedding, graduation, the birth of a baby, or a senior person’s birthday, and even funerals. It is a traditional way to wish good luck and share blessings. Red envelopes are rich in design and decoration.
